Output e3f8e59c995cbf6c7cefd154b3ed8da63fc3d45f57a30fc49b64d0d99ea7cada:1

value
2689118
script pubkey
OP_0 OP_PUSHBYTES_20 dd8f30a8e41be1a15a7d89f1475eb0da7b106234
address
bc1qmk8np28yr0s6zkna38c5wh4smfa3qc353x8rjz
transaction
e3f8e59c995cbf6c7cefd154b3ed8da63fc3d45f57a30fc49b64d0d99ea7cada
spent
true